- The distance between Minya, Egypt and Neustrelitz, Germany is approximately 3,159 km or 1,963 mi.
- To reach Minya in this distance one would set out from Neustrelitz bearing 145.8°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Minya bearing 157.6° or SSE .
- Minya has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Neustrelitz has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Minya is in or near the subtropical desert biome whereas Neustrelitz is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 13 °C (23.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2 °C (3.6°F) less in Minya.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 548 mm (21.6 in) less which is equivalent to 548 l/m² (13.45 US gal/ft²) or 5,480,000 l/ha (585,848 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 25.2° higher in Minya than in Neustrelitz.
- Relative humidity levels are 17.2%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 8°C (14.3°F) higher.
